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Llansamlet to Huncoat start from as little as £27.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Llansamlet to Huncoat start from £105.20 one way, or £150.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Llansamlet to Huncoat are available for £115.40 one way, or £230.80 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ities

Llansamlet station is a no-frills, straightforward station that prioritizes efficient travel over extravagance. The station lacks a ticket office and ticket machines, so it's recommended to purchase your tickets online in advance. This allows you to streamline your travel plans without any hassle.

While there's a lack of seating rooms, the station offers step-free access on both platforms, making it fairly accessible. The car park is managed by the City and County of Swansea Council, providing 20 parking spaces for free, with some remnants of accessibility as there's no specific accessible equipment or designated spaces.

Accessibility and Assistance

If you require assistance during your journey, Llansamlet offers features such as an induction loop and ramps for train access - although bear in mind staff assistance needs to be arranged beforehand. Interestingly, the station's design includes step-free access via a ramp for Platform 1 and easy access to Platform 2 from Frederick Place.

The station's limited assistance facilities underscore the importance of planning your visit carefully—if you need additional support, don't forget to make arrangements through the Passenger Assist program.

Onward Travel and Connections

As for onward travel, Llansamlet provides several options. The nearest bus stop is conveniently located at Frederick Place, making it easy to hop onto local buses. Additionally, for those needing alternative rail transport, a rail replacement bus service is available from the station entrance. However, if you're looking to rent a bicycle, note that there are no cycle hire facilities directly at the station.

Facilities and Amenities at Huncoat Station

Huncoat station provides essential services for a convenient travel experience. Despite a lack of a staffed ticket office, you'll find ticket machines on-site, allowing you to collect pre-booked tickets with ease. Located on Platform 1, these machines are accessible for all passengers, ensuring smooth travel for everyone, including those with mobility challenges. While the station lacks facilities like waiting rooms or restrooms, it’s heartening to know that seating areas are available for passengers to use while waiting for their trains.

Accessibility is considered, though Huncoat offers only partial step-free access, making it essential for those with specific requirements to check ahead. With no dedicated staff presence, assistance at the station is provided by the train's conductor, and passengers can request help via platforms. For those needing advance support, remembering the Passenger Assist service is invaluable.

Onward Travel Options

If you’re planning onward travel from Huncoat, options are available to integrate your rail journey smoothly with other transport modes. For occasional disruptions, a rail replacement bus service can be caught from Station Road, conveniently positioned near local landmarks. However, the station doesn't house taxi services directly, yet with modern conveniences, you can easily book a ride through online platforms such as Northern Railway’s [Cab4You](https://www.northernrailway.co.uk/tickets/cab4you).

While bicycle hire is not currently available, travelers can benefit from local bus services. For up-to-date bus schedules and more information, Busline at 0871 200 2233 could be your go-to contact for seamless planning of your travels.
